  • Applications

    4-Butyloxazole (CAS 79886-36-5) is primarily used as an organic synthesis intermediate and building block in chemical development. In practice, it is often employed in pharmaceutical and agrochemical R&D to assemble heterocyclic scaffolds for potential active ingredients. It also acts as a precursor for specialty chemicals in materials science, including oxazole-containing polymers and dyes. Additionally, it appears in exploratory work for electronics and optoelectronics applications, where oxazole motifs are studied for functional properties. In research settings, it may serve as a versatile starting material for the synthesis of more complex molecules via standard cross-coupling and functionalization reactions.
